The Bostitch is the better pneumatic fastening tool line of Stanley Black and Decker. On the contrary, DeWalt is the pro construction and woodworking tool line of Stanley Black and Decker. DeWalt deals with worldwide platforms, whereas Bostitch mainly deals in America only.

What is Bostitch brand?

Stanley Bostitch, previously and more commonly known as simply Bostitch, is an American company that specializes in the design and manufacture of fastening tools—such as staplers, staple guns, nailers, riveters, and glue guns—and fasteners—such as nails, screws, and staples.

Can you use different brand nails in nail guns?

A: You can use any brand nails as long as they are the same degree as your nailers and are within the length set for your gun.

Do all nail guns use the same nails?

Different types of nail guns can be used with different nail lengths. A typical brad nailer, for example, shoots nails that are 3/8 inch to 1 1/4 inches in length, while a larger framing nailer typically shoots nails from 2 to 3 1/2 inches in length.
